Tetragrammaton
Noun
1.
Tetragrammaton
- four Hebrew letters usually transliterated as YHWH (Yahweh) or JHVH (Jehovah) signifying the Hebrew name for God which the Jews regarded as too holy to pronounce
tetragram
- a word that is written with four letters in an alphabetic writing system
